There’s more to Portugal’s famous Algarve than blue-flag beaches, golf courses and swanky resorts. Scratch beneath the surface of this holiday mecca by visiting the wild western coast, where you’ll ramble through protected parks and traverse trails along burnt-orange clifftops home to lighthouses and forts. Stay in the port town of Lagos with its mosaiced lanes and church-studded squares encircled by 16th-century walls. From here, the Atlantic’s surf-worthy monster waves have carved elaborate sea arches and rock stacks along the coastline, culminating at the nearby Ponta da Piedade. 

Each day, your group will embark upon relaxed walks along coastal trails that lead through whitewashed fishing villages where you can pick up some of Portugal's signature pasteis de nata, creamy custard tarts. Stop at isolated golden coves on your way to Sagres, where a striking lighthouse marks the most southwesterly point in Europe and a kaleidoscope of seabirds nest; here you’ll discover Portugal’s nautical past and the remains of a 15th-century fort. 

However, it’s the Cabo de São Vicente Nature Reserve that really steals the show. Follow trails through the reserve’s seaside villages, across desolate dunes and remote countryside that flourishes with spring wildflowers, to cliffs overlooking honey-hued coves. Finally, for aerial views of the Algarve’s paradisical coastline, head inland, spiralling upwards to the Monchique mountains where trails lead through dense forests to Roman spa towns and the 902-metre-tall Foia peak – the Algarve’s highest – which offers unblemished coastal views.
